Fuel Gas Conditioning Systems are designed to protect natural gas
fueled engines and turbines from liquid slugs, solids ( lt; 0.1
microns) and liquid aerosols. Additionally, with a combination of a
heater, the fuel gas is superheated above the hydrocarbon and water dew
points to prevent liquid condensation in the turbine s combustion
chambers. Our systems meet or exceed engine and turbine manufacturers
fuel gas quality specifications providing dry, clean fuel to increase
the life of the equipment.
